2022 AWD Tucson

The AWD (All wheel drive) 2022 Tucson Hybrid vehicle offers the best in style and performance. The prices deserve a second look, as the starting price is $29,750.  Now that gas prices are extremely high, it is good to know that you can travel the world and enjoy savings of up to 38 miles per gallon on the highway and up to 59 hp/44.2 kW. Not many vehicles can deliver on style, quality, and affordability. But then again, every vehicle is not a Tucson.

Additional features too good to pass up:

  • Dual automatic climate control
  • Bluetooth technology
  • Three trim levels
  • Heated driver and passenger seats
  • Lumbar support driver seat with power controls
  • Large 8” inch touchscreen media system
  • USB charging ports
  • Cargo capacity with a folded rear seat of 74.5 cubic feet
  • Combined 226 hp
  • Turbocharged 1.6 liters (four-cylinder engine
  • Electric motor
  • Automatic six-speed transmission

2023 Kia Sportage

Starting at $28,585, you can select your own style of Kia trim. The stylish interior displays a large 12.3-inch digital panel and touchscreen display. The model is a front-wheel drive with a 1.6 four-cylinder engine, combined with an electric engine, that puts out 227 horsepower.

Key Features:

  • Automatic transmission
  • Six-speed transmission (automatic)
  • Combined 43 mpg
  • Surround view camera
  • Android and Apple CarPlay
  • 12.3 digital screen
  • Backseat space 39.5 cubic feet
  • Panoramic sunroof
  • Metal door handles
  • Collision avoidance assistance in reverse parking
  • Blind spot avoidance collision

BMW 5 Series

BMW has a reputation for being a pricey, luxurious vehicle. That in itself is true. What you didn’t expect is to find that the BMW is more affordable than most luxury vehicles, similar in style and class. Priced at $56,545, the Series 5 comes with the latest in upgrades in Bluetooth technology and more. The BMW Series 5 can go from 0-60 miles per hour in less than 6 seconds. That is impressive.

Other Features:

  • Automatic 8-speed shift transmission
  • 4-cylinder engine
  • Electric and gas engine (hybrid)
  • Charges battery in three hours
  • 64 miles per gallon combined
  • 26 miles per gallon on gas only
  • 12.1 fuel tank capacity
  • Rear wheel drive
  • Seats five people
  • 288 horsepower
  • Four One touch power window
